Study in Montevideo, Uruguay
  • Experience a unique opportunity to study and explore the Rio de la Plata region of Uruguay and Argentina, including its Spanish, Italian and African cultural influences.
  • Take courses in Spanish, activism and gender, Latin American studies, business, viticulture and agribusiness in one of the most important universities in the country.
  • Live in and enjoy the thriving cultural scene of Montevideo: tango, carnival, ferias, live shows and theatre are part of daily life. Montevideo is consistently rated as having the highest quality of life of any city in Latin America.
  • Discover some of the most exotic places in South America with the tours offered, the breathtaking and lively Buenos Aires, the historical Colonia del Sacramento city, amazing Patagonia and one of the new seven wonders of the world, Iguazu Falls.
  • Explore the outdoor way of life in Montevideo specially along La Rambla, with several beaches, public festivals and sports.

Program Costs
  • The cost of the program is equivalent to one semester of on-campus charges: tuition, room and board, and fees. The program charges cover all academic costs, housing, meals, and academic excursions during the course of the program. 
  • The program fees do not include costs of round-trip transportation to and from program location, passport fees, visa expenses, personal travel, books, or personal items. 

Financial Aid
Students are eligible to apply their financial aid to one Earlham or Earlham-approved off-campus program during their college career.

Earlham Scholarships
Travel awards are available to assist students who want to study abroad with an Earlham program but find it difficult to manage the added expense of airfare. The funds are to be used for expenses related to travel to and from the destination of your program. Students are selected for these scholarships based on the quality of their scholarship application combined with a demonstrated financial need, as determined by the Center for Global Education in consultation with the Financial Aid Office.

Application Process
The application process involves the completion of multiple steps:
  1. Submit the Application for Earlham-Approved Off-Campus Study Programs.
  2. Complete an interview with a campus program representative.
  3. Receive approval from Earlham.
  4. Complete the specific program application.
  5. Receive notification from the program provider about your acceptance to the program.
